实验二 创建数据库和表

实验二 创建数据库和表

ID:38698496

大小:339.00 KB

页数:9页

时间:2019-06-17

实验二   创建数据库和表_第1页
实验二   创建数据库和表_第2页
实验二   创建数据库和表_第3页
实验二   创建数据库和表_第4页
实验二   创建数据库和表_第5页
资源描述:

《实验二 创建数据库和表》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、2013140期010512132122102013139期070811132127082013138期041516242728032013137期041719232427102013136期040614161826062013135期092324252931122013134期011718192529102013133期040712192225012013132期202122232527122013131期04061217192609实验二创建数据库和表一、实验目的与要求1.了解SQLServer数据库的逻

2、辑结构和物理结构。2.了解表的结构特点。3.了解SQLServer的基本数据类型。4.了解空值概念。5.学会在企业管理器中创建数据库和表。6.学会使用T-SQL语句创建数据库和表。二、实验设备及环境装有SQLServer2000的计算机1台/人三、背景知识1.SQLServer2000的数据库对象在SQLServer2000中,数据库由包含数据的表集合和其他对象(如关系图、视图、索引、规则、默认值、存储过程和触发器等)组成,目的是为执行与数据有关的活动提供支持。2.SQLServer2000的数据库文件SQL

3、Server2000采用操作系统文件来存放数据库,数据库文件可分为主数据文件、次级数据文件和事务日志文件共3类。u主数据文件(Primary)主数据文件用来存放数据,它是所有数据库文件的起点(包含指向其他数据库文件的指针)。每个数据库都必须包含也只能包含一个主数据文件。主数据文件的默认扩展名为.MDF。例如,学生管理系统的主数据文件名为“XSGL_Data.MDF”。u次数据文件(Secondary)二级数据文件也用来存放数据。一个数据库中,可以没有二级数据文件,也可以拥有多个二级数据文件。二级数据文件的默认

4、扩展名为.NDF。u事务日志文件(TransactionLog)事务日志文件用来存放事务日志。事务日志记录了SQLServer所有的事务和由这些事务引起的数据库的变化。每个数据库至少有一个日志文件,也可以拥有多个日志文件。日志文件的默认扩展名为.LDF。例如,学生管理系统的日志文件名为“XSGL_Log.LDF”。一般情况下,一个数据库至少由一个主数据文件和一个事务日志文件组成。也可以根据实际需要,给数据库设置多个次数据文件和其他日志文件,并将它们放在不同的磁盘上。3.SQLServer中创建数据库的方法SQ

5、LServer中创建数据库有三种方法:一是通过向导创建,二是在企业管理器中使用现成的命令和功能交互式创建;三是在查询分析器中书写TransactSQL语句创建。4.SQLServer中创建表的方法SQLServer中创建表也有三种方法:一是通过向导创建,二是在企业管理器中使用现成的命令和功能交互式创建;三是在查询分析器中书写TransactSQL语句创建。5.创建数据库的语句创建数据库可以使用CREATEDATABASE语句,该语句简化的语法格式如下:CREATEDATABASE database_name[

6、[ON[filespec]][LOGON[filespec]]]filespec定义为:([NAME=logical_file_name,]FILENAME='os_file_name'[,SIZE=size][,MAXSIZE={max_size

7、UNLIMITED}][,FILEGROWTH=growth_INcrement])其中:database_name指出新数据库的名称。数据库名称在服务器中必须惟一,并且符合标识符的规则。ON子句指定显式定义用来存储数据库数据部分的磁盘文件(数据文件)。该关键字后

8、跟以逗号分隔的“filespec”项列表,“filespec”项用以定义主文件组的数据文件。LOGON子句指定显式定义用来存储数据库日志的磁盘文件(日志文件)。该关键字后跟以逗号分隔的“filespec”项列表,“filespec”项用以定义日志文件。FILENAME为“filespec”定义的文件指定操作系统文件名。“os_file_name”指出操作系统创建“filespec”定义的物理文件时使用的路径名和文件名。SIZE子句指定“filespec”中定义的文件的大小。“size”为“filespec”中

9、定义的文件的初始大小,可以使用千字节(KB)、兆字节(MB)、千兆字节(GB)或兆兆字节(TB)后缀。默认值为MB。指定一个整数,不要包含小数位,“size”的最小值为512KB。如果没有指定“size”,则默认值为1MB。为主文件指定的大小至少应与model数据库的主文件大小相同。MAXSIZE子句指定“filespec”中定义的文件可以增长到的最大大小。“max_size”指出“filespec

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。